NF-κB Activation in T Helper 17 Cell Differentiation

CD28/T cell receptor ligation activates the NF-κB signaling cascade during CD4 T cell activation. NF-κB activation is required for cytokine gene expression and activated T cell survival and proliferation. Recently, many reports showed that NF-κB activation is also involved in T helper (Th) cell differentiation including Th17 cell differentiation. In this review, we discuss the current literature on NF-κB activation pathway and its effect on Th17 cell differentiation.
